Sydney

I was 18 in 1968. I had sex for the first time - unprotected because the student health center at my University would not provide birth control without parental permission. When I found out I was pregnant I knew I was not fit to be a parent at that time. I heard rumors of Mexican abortions. Through friends of friends of acquaintances, I found a "clinic" in Juarez Mexico.
